- Summary: China and the United States have agreed in the past two weeks to cancel tariffs imposed during their months-long trade war in phases, the Chinese commerce ministry said on Thursday (November 7). China and the United States should simultaneously cancel tariffs on each other's goods if a "phase one" trade deal is reached, the ministry's spokesman Gao Feng told reporters at a regular briefing in Beijing. The tariff cancellation is an important condition for there to be any agreement, Gao said.
